blockly > Etkinlikler

Etkinlik ad alanı

Sınıflar

Sınıf Açıklama
BlockBase Bloklarla ilgili tüm etkinlikler için soyut sınıf.
BlockChange Bir bloğun bazı öğeleri (ör.alan değerleri, yorumlar vb.) değiştiğinde işleyicileri bilgilendirir.
BlockCreate Bir blok (veya bağlı blok yığını) oluşturulduğunda dinleyicileri bilgilendirir.
BlockDelete Bir blok (veya bağlı blok yığını) silindiğinde işleyicileri bilgilendirir.
BlockDrag Bir blok manuel olarak sürüklenip bırakıldığında dinleyicileri bilgilendirir.
BlockFieldIntermediateChange Bir blok alanının değeri değiştiğinde ancak değişiklik henüz tamamlanmadığında ve bunu bir engelleme değişikliği etkinliği izlemesi beklendiğinde işleyicileri bilgilendirir.
BlockMove Bir blok taşındığında işleyicileri bilgilendirir. Bu bağlantı, bir bağlantıdan diğerine veya çalışma alanındaki bir konumdan diğerine olabilir.
BubbleOpen Balon açma etkinliği dersi.
Tıklama sayısı Dinleyicilere ome bloklu öğenin tıklandığını bildirir.
CommentBase Bir yorum etkinliği için soyut sınıf.
CommentChange Dinleyicilere bir çalışma alanı yorumunun içeriğinin değiştiğini bildirir.
CommentCreate Dinleyicilere bir çalışma alanı yorumunun oluşturulduğunu bildirir.
CommentDelete Dinleyicilere bir çalışma alanı yorumunun silindiğini bildirir.
CommentMove İşleyicilere, bir çalışma alanı yorumunun taşındığını bildirir.
FinishedLoading Çalışma alanı JSON/XML'den serileştirme işlemi tamamlandığında işleyicileri bilgilendirir.
MarkerMove Dinleyicilere bir işaretçinin (klavyeyle gezinme için kullanılır) hareket ettiğini bildirir.
Seçili Seçili etkinlik için sınıf. Dinleyicilere yeni bir öğenin seçildiğini bildirir.
ThemeChange Dinleyicilere çalışma alanı temasının değiştiğini bildirir.
ToolboxItemSelect Dinleyicilere bir araç kutusu öğesinin seçildiğini bildirir.
TrashcanOpen Çöp kutusu açıldığında veya kapandığında dinleyicileri bilgilendirir.
UiBase Bir kullanıcı arayüzü etkinliği için temel sınıf. Kullanıcı arayüzü etkinlikleri, çok kullanıcılı düzenlemenin çalışması için kablo üzerinden gönderilmesi gerekmeyen etkinliklerdir (ör. çalışma alanını kaydırma, yakınlaştırma, araç kutusu kategorilerini açma). Kullanıcı arayüzü etkinlikleri geri alınamaz veya yeniden yapılmaz.
VarBase Değişken bir etkinliğe ait soyut sınıf.
VarCreate Dinleyicilere bir değişken modelinin oluşturulduğunu bildirir.
VarDelete

İşleyicilere bir değişken modelinin silindiğini bildirir.

VarRename

İşleyicilere bir değişken modelinin yeniden adlandırıldığını bildirir.

ViewportChange

Dinleyicilere çalışma alanı yüzeyinin konumunun veya ölçeğinin değiştiğini bildirir.

Çalışma alanının kendisi yeniden boyutlandırıldığında bildirim almaz.

Soyut Sınıflar

Soyut Ders Açıklama
Soyut Etkinlikle ilgili soyut sınıf.

Sıralamalar

Sıralama Açıklama
BubbleType
ClickTarget

Arayüzler

Arayüz Açıklama
AbstractEventJson
BlockBaseJson
BlockChangeJson
BlockCreateJson
BlockDeleteJson
BlockDragJson
BlockFieldIntermediateChangeJson
BlockMoveJson
BubbleOpenJson
ClickJson
CommentBaseJson
CommentChangeJson
CommentCreateJson
CommentMoveJson
MarkerMoveJson
SelectedJson
ThemeChangeJson
ToolboxItemSelectJson
TrashcanOpenJson
VarBaseJson
VarCreateJson
VarDeleteJson
VarRenameJson
ViewportChangeJson

Değişkenler

Değişken Açıklama
BLOCK_CHANGE
BLOCK_CREATE
BLOCK_DELETE
BLOCK_DRAG
BLOCK_FIELD_INTERMEDIATE_CHANGE
BLOCK_MOVE
BUBBLE_OPEN
BUMP_EVENTS
DEĞİŞTİR
clearPendingUndo
TIKLAMA
COMMENT_CHANGE
COMMENT_CREATE
COMMENT_DELETE
COMMENT_MOVE
OLUŞTURUN
SİL
devre dışı bırak
disableOrphans
enable
filtre
FINISHED_LOADING
yangın
fromJson
al
getDescendantIds
getGroup
getRecordUndo
isEnabled
MARKER_MOVE
TAŞI
SEÇİLENLER
setGroup
setRecordUndo
THEME_CHANGE
TOOLBOX_ITEM_SELECT
TRASHCAN_OPEN
Kullanıcı arayüzü
VAR_CREATE
VAR_DELETE
VAR_RENAME
VIEWPORT_CHANGE

Takma Adları Yazın

Tür Takma Adı Açıklama
BumpEvent